var request = require('request');
var pathVarsRe = /\${([^\}]+)}/g;
function getPathVars(path) {
var pathVars = [];
var match;
while ((match = pathVarsRe.exec(path)) !== null) {
pathVars.push(match[1]);
}
return pathVars;
}
function parse(pathPattern) {
var splitByQuestionMark = pathPattern.split('?');
return {
withoutParams: splitByQuestionMark[0],
params: splitByQuestionMark.length > 1 ? splitByQuestionMark[1].split('|') : [],
pathVars: getPathVars(pathPattern),
};
}
function uriJoin(a, b) {
if (!a.endsWith('/')) {
a = a + '/';
}
if (b.startsWith('/')) {
b = b.substr(1);
}
return a + b;
}
function buildUri(root, args, parseResult) {
var uri = uriJoin(root, parseResult.withoutParams);
var params = [];
Object.keys(args).forEach(function (key) {
var value = args[key];
var pathVarIndex = parseResult.pathVars.indexOf(key);
var paramsIndex;
if (pathVarIndex !== -1) {
uri = uri.replace('${' + key + '}', value);
} else if ((paramsIndex = parseResult.params.indexOf(key)) !== -1) {
params.push(key + '=' + value);
}
});
if (params.length) {
uri = uri + '?' + params.join('&');
}
return uri;
}
function buildWrapperFn(root, parseResult, method, requestModule, requestOptions, shouldParseJson) {
requestOptions = requestOptions || {};
if ([ 'patch', 'post', 'put' ].indexOf(method) !== -1) {
return function () {
var args = arguments['0'];
var body = arguments['1'];
var moreRequestOptions = arguments.length === 4 ? arguments['2'] : {};
var cb = arguments.length === 4 ? arguments['3'] : arguments['2'];
var uri = buildUri(root, args, parseResult);
var next = shouldParseJson ? getParseJsonFn(cb) : cb;
Object.assign(requestOptions, moreRequestOptions);
requestOptions.uri = uri;
requestOptions.method = method.toUpperCase();
requestOptions.body = body;
return requestModule(requestOptions, next);
}
} else {
return function () {
var args = arguments['0'];
var moreRequestOptions = arguments.length === 3 ? arguments['1'] : {};
var cb = arguments.length === 3 ? arguments['2'] : arguments['1'];
var uri = buildUri(root, args, parseResult);
var next = shouldParseJson ? getParseJsonFn(cb) : cb;
Object.assign(requestOptions, moreRequestOptions);
requestOptions.uri = uri;
requestOptions.method = method.toUpperCase();
return requestModule(requestOptions, next);
}
}
}
function getParseJsonFn(cb) {
return function (error, message, body) {
var parsedBody;
if (error) {
cb(error);
} else {
try {
parsedBody = JSON.parse(body);
} catch (e) {
cb('Could not parse JSON');
}
cb(null, message, parsedBody);
}
};
}
function getMethodIterator(config, cb) {
var httpMethods = [ 'delete', 'get', 'head', 'patch', 'post', 'put' ];
httpMethods.forEach(function (method) {
var methodMap = config[method];
if (methodMap) {
Object.keys(methodMap).forEach(function (key) {
var value = methodMap[key];
cb(method, key, value);
});
}
});
}
module.exports.create = function (config) {
var root = config.root;
var shouldParseJson = config.parseJson;
var requestDefaults = config.requestDefaults;
var requestModule = requestDefaults ? request.defaults(requestDefaults) : request;
var wrapper = {};
getMethodIterator(config, function (method, key, value) {
var pathPattern;
var requestOptions;
var parseResult;
if (typeof value === 'string') {
pathPattern = value;
requestOptions = null;
} else {
pathPattern = value.pathPattern;
requestOptions = value.requestOptions;
}
parseResult = parse(pathPattern);
wrapper[key] = buildWrapperFn(root, parseResult, method, requestModule, requestOptions, shouldParseJson);
});
return wrapper;
}
